Memphis Depay engraved his name into Dutch football history last week and overtook Robin van Persie to become the leading goal scorer of the Netherlands with his 51st and 52nd goals.
To mark the milestone, Puma has teamed up with the striker to create the MD51 Ultra-a limited design, which tells the story of his trip both on and outside the field.
The boots are based on a white base and contain contrasting colors: one in blue and black to reflect family, faith and culture, others in orange and black to capture its football triumph. The details include his famous lion tattoo, number 10, the homage to his Ghanaian roots and an allusion to his mother Cora.
But the fans will not be able to copy them. There are only 51 couples who each go directly to the people who have shaped his life – from family to mentors and close friends.
“I was a little boy with big dreams; a young animal became a lion on the largest stage,” said Depay. “The top scorer of becoming the Netherlands is a real honor … I wanted to celebrate by giving the people who helped me a special sign of my appreciation.”
For Depay, it’s less about Hype drops and more about a personal thank you. And for everyone else? Another memory that the man with the lion on his chest is now roaring the loudest in the Dutch football history.
